Career path
| Career Role | Description |
|---|---|
| Cybersecurity Incident Responder (Primary: Incident Response; Secondary: Security Analyst) | Investigates and resolves cybersecurity incidents, ensuring business continuity and data protection. High demand in the UK's growing digital landscape. |
| Compliance Manager (Primary: Regulatory Compliance; Secondary: Risk Management) | Manages the organization's compliance with relevant cybersecurity regulations (GDPR, NIS2 etc.), minimizing legal and financial risks. Crucial for maintaining regulatory trust. |
| Security Auditor (Primary: Security Audit; Secondary: Vulnerability Management) | Conducts regular security audits to identify vulnerabilities and ensure compliance standards are met. Essential for proactive risk mitigation. |
| Data Loss Prevention Specialist (Primary: Data Loss Prevention; Secondary: Forensics) | Develops and implements strategies to prevent data breaches and loss. Critical for protecting sensitive information. |
| Senior Cybersecurity Consultant (Primary: Cybersecurity Consulting; Secondary: Incident Response) | Provides expert advice to organizations on cybersecurity strategies, incident response planning, and regulatory compliance. Highly sought after for strategic guidance. |
